The ingredients needed to make Etinkeni Mmong Ikong:
- Take 2 bunch water leaf
- Prepare 1 bunch uziza leaf
- Get 1/2 kilo beef or goat meat
- Make ready 2 medium Dry fish
- Prepare 1 stock fish
- Make ready 1 tbspn Crayfish
- Get Ponmo
- Make ready 2 spoons palm oil
- Make ready Scotch bonnet pepper
- Get 5 seasoning cubes
- Take Salt

Steps to make Etinkeni Mmong Ikong:
- Get the ingredients ready slice the water leaf as thinly as possible
- Place a pot over heat pour in the beef,stockfish, dry fish and ponmo add the seasoning cubes and salt.
- Pour some water and allow to cook until the water is almost dry add the blended pepper give it a stir cover and allow to continue cooking.
- Pound the crayfish and the opehe together add to the pot add some Palm oil into it. Allow the water to almost dry up as the water leaf also has water.
- Add the water leaf and uziza leaf into the pot and give it a good stir.
- When the leaves wilt allow to cook through and it's ready to serve.
- Serve with your favourite swallow I served mine with fufu.

The Nigerian Edikang Ikong soup or simply Vegetable Soup is native to the Efiks, people from Akwa Ibom and Cross River states of Nigeria.
